// MAX_PICKUP_RADIUS_KM — don't touch this casually.
// The Fernhollow dispatch heuristic assigns drivers by scoring
// distance against acceptance rate. Bumping this radius past 12
// floods rural drivers with jobs they'll decline, and the retry
// storm pages whoever's on call (probably you). If you must tune
// it, test against the Oakmere replay set first. The last
// validated build token is noted below.

build token for fajof-yahof: htk4_869f

# Break-Glass Access: StringHarvest Extraction Script

Plugin authors normally run StringHarvest through the Lintvale sandbox, which scopes extraction to your plugin's manifest. In genuine emergencies — a corrupted catalog blocking a release — break-glass mode grants full-tree extraction. Use it sparingly; every invocation is logged and reviewed. Activating break-glass mode prompts for the recovery passphrase, which is kept directly below this section:

strongbox words: fenwyn-lamix-novael-holeth-sorix-druael-lamwyn

## Snapshot Testing Environment

The Glimmerkit UI suite renders component snapshots in a headless harness before comparison. Reviewers should confirm that `SNAPSHOT_MODE=strict` is set in CI, since loose mode masks layout regressions. Visual diffs are uploaded to the Pindrop artifact store, which requires authentication from the runner. Before approving a pipeline change, verify the env file includes the upload token on the next line.

vault entry, bagaf-fahog: ARCHIVE_KEY3=71e

## Brightholm Term Sheet — Overview (Restricted: Managers)

Heads up, department leads: the Brightholm Cooperative term sheet is now in its third draft and looking solid. Key terms — joint development of the Skylane module, 50/50 cost split on tooling, and a two-year renewal option tied to performance milestones. Their lawyers pushed back on our change-of-control clause, but we held firm. Target signature is end of next month. The broader play this supports is described immediately below.

confidential, kagup-bafog: Fraaxax Group is in early talks to buy Soroxox Group for about $343.8 million. The Olidor launch date is June 14, and nothing goes to the press before then. Legal wants the Aldmirek Logistics term sheet signed before July 23.